Fresh Drone Sightings Over Danish Bases Put Europe on Alert

Allies describe a hybrid campaign and accelerate air-defense measures after Ukraine reported stopping dozens of hostile UAVs bound for Poland.

Overview

  • Danish police and the armed forces confirmed sightings of unidentified drones over the Karup and Skrydstrup military bases overnight, following earlier incursions near major airports.
  • President Volodymyr Zelensky said Ukraine intercepted 92 drones headed toward Poland and warned that Italy could be targeted next, as Italy’s foreign minister said national defenses are prepared.
  • NATO chiefs meeting in Riga pledged a strengthened yet proportional response to airspace violations, while EU commissioner Valdis Dombrovskis backed new collective defenses, including a proposed ‘wall of drones’ and the Prontezza 2030 rearmament plan.
  • Russia’s Sergei Lavrov rejected accusations that Moscow is targeting EU or NATO states and warned of a firm response to any aggression, even as Russian forces claimed the capture of three villages in eastern Ukraine.
  • Ukrainian authorities reported fresh strikes, with injuries in Kyiv and Zaporizhzhia overnight and dozens of recent attacks in the Chernihiv region, as Poland launched air patrols and briefly restricted airspace near Lublin during Russia’s long-range operations against Ukraine.
